The scheme provides grant … WebPrices vary, but an average price would be about £700 per square. A small cottage (say, 25 ft × 25 ft) with a 45° roof would have a roof area of 900 ft². That would cost about £6,500 to install. A large detached house with several dormer windows and two chimney breasts would probably be in the region of £25,000 to £35,000. hr investigation questions shrm https://amaaradesigns.com

WebMay 17, 2024 · A £200,000 fund aimed at supporting roof repairs to listed buildings is now open. Owners can avail of £5,000 for repair works associated with roofs including chimneys and gutters while £10,000 is available for the repair of thatched roofs. This is part of a £350,000 Executive package of support being provided to the built heritage sector ... Thatch is a traditional roofing material in many parts of England. It has rich regional traditions that contribute to the local distinctiveness of vernacular buildings.
